WooCommerce:自定义功能,用于管理各个属性级别的可变产品库存

时间:2015-06-11 17:01:10

标签: php wordpress woocommerce

如何创建自定义功能以管理各个属性级别的库存?

例如

产品我签名的T恤

  • 属性1:大小 - 小|中|大
  • 属性2:标记颜色 - 蓝色|红色|黑

在这种情况下,您只想按属性1管理库存。按属性2管理股票也没有意义。

我尝试过什么

由于我刚开始使用自定义WordPress功能,因此我不知道从哪里开始。似乎由SKU过滤的自定义库存减少功能可以工作,但我已经搜索过,无法找到任何可用的示例。

注意:我的实际使用案例是通过WooCommerce订阅在不同日期提供的不同付款选项:

产品:学习研讨会

  • 属性1:上课日 - 周一下午1点|星期三上午10点。
  • 属性2:付款选项 - 单笔付款| 2付款| 4付款

1 个答案:

答案 0 :(得分:0)

我知道这是一个非常老的问题,但是我有几个客户要求这种基于基于属性的的库存管理,所以我最终为其开发了一个插件:{{3 }}

想法是,您可以直接根据属性条件设置库存,这将在购买匹配产品时适当扣除。

例如:您可以在每个Size属性项上设置库存,并禁用产品/变体的库存管理,以便仅在属性级别上管理库存。 / p>